Helena Bonham Carter Biography

Helena Bonham Carter is an English actress known for her roles in both independent art films and large-scale blockbusters, like Fight Club and the Harry Potter series.

Her launch into the world of acting came in 1979, when she entered, and won, a national writing contest, and used the money won to pay for her entry into the actor's directory, Spotlight. In 1983, she made her professional acting debut in her first major role, A Pattern of Roses, a made-for-television movie, followed by Lady Jane and A Room with a View. She later appeared in "Hamlet" as the iconic Ophelia, and later in Howards End, Frankenstein, and Mighty Aphrodite. Her first Academy Award nomination came from her performance in "The Wings of the Dove" in 1997. She later expanded her range, and now has an impressive background including films like Fight Club, Planet of The Apes, Big Fish, Charlie and the Chocolate Factory, Corpse Bride, Harry Potter, and Alice in Wonderland.

In 2011 Bonham Carter was nominated for a second Academy Award, for her role as Queen Elizabeth alongside Colin Firth’s King George VI in The King’s Speech. She subsequently appeared on-screen in Les Misérables, The Lone Ranger, Cinderella, Suffragette, and Ocean's 8. In 2016, she reprised her role as the Red Queen from Alice in Wonderland in the sequel Alice Through the Looking Glass. Although much of Bonham Carter's accreditation is through film, she has made numerous appearances on the small screen, and has appeared as a series regular on "The Crown" since 2019.

In addition to her film roles, Bonham Carter has appeared in several stage plays in her native England, including "The Tempest", "Trelawny of the “Wells”", and "The Barber of Seville". She made several appearances in BBC radio plays and TV movies, including "Burton & Taylor", "Turks & Caicos" and "Salting the Battlefield".
